Active Energy Group plc
("Active Energy", the "Company" or the "Group")
Operational Update on Initial 8 MVA UAE Deployment Site
Further to the Company's announcements on 24 April 2026 and 28 April 2026 regarding the proposed collaboration with Bitdeer Technologies Group (NASDAQ: BTDR) ("Bitdeer"), Active Energy is pleased to confirm that the initial 8 MVA UAE site is now prepared and ready to receive the modular data infrastructure expected to be deployed by its proposed JV partners for operational use.
The Company is currently working alongside its proposed JV partners in relation to final deployment planning, logistics and delivery scheduling associated with the modular infrastructure.

Indicative Economic Model
As previously announced, the proposed infrastructure-led model is expected to position Active Energy as the power, hosting and operational delivery partner, with Bitdeer deploying mining infrastructure and equipment.
Subject to final terms and operating conditions, the Company previously outlined indicative economics of:
· Approximately US$300,000 revenue per MVA per annum from infrastructure and power hosting
· Approximately 8.3 BTC production per MVA per annum, subject to network conditions
The Board believes the pilot deployment structure provides a scalable and lower-risk pathway toward larger-scale deployment opportunities across the UAE.
There can be no certainty that any definitive agreement will be entered into or that these indicative economics will ultimately be achieved.
